Ci-dessous, les différences entre deux révisions de la page.
| Les deux révisions précédentesRévision précédenteProchaine révision | Révision précédente | ||
| tma:pv:procedures:extractions_automatiques_sql [26/04/2019 13:27] – [Script Powershell] emmanuel.stahl | tma:pv:procedures:extractions_automatiques_sql [26/06/2019 16:02] (Version actuelle) – [III. Exécution du script] emmanuel.stahl | ||
|---|---|---|---|
| Ligne 1: | Ligne 1: | ||
| - | ====== Extractions automatiques | + | ====== Extractions automatiques |
| Cette procédure explique comment extraire automatiquement des données sur SQL automatiquement à l'aide d'un script powershell. | Cette procédure explique comment extraire automatiquement des données sur SQL automatiquement à l'aide d'un script powershell. | ||
| //Remarque : Le script présenté dans cette procédure a été conçu initialement pour extraire des données d'AB sur une base de données Conext Control. Il est possible de l' | //Remarque : Le script présenté dans cette procédure a été conçu initialement pour extraire des données d'AB sur une base de données Conext Control. Il est possible de l' | ||
| - | ===== Script Powershell ===== | + | ===== I. Script Powershell ===== |
| Le script Powershell est le suivant : | Le script Powershell est le suivant : | ||
| Ligne 13: | Ligne 13: | ||
| Il se situe également sur le serveur AI : **// | Il se situe également sur le serveur AI : **// | ||
| - | ===== Chapitre 2 ===== | + | ===== II. Paramétrage |
| - | <WRAP center round download 60> | + | Dans cette partie, nous allons voir les quelques paramètres du script à modifier selon l' |
| - | bloc information | + | |
| - | </ | + | Tout d' |
| - | <WRAP center round info 60> | + | |
| - | bloc information | + | ==== 1. Choix des ID à extraire ==== |
| - | </ | + | Comme indiqué sur l' |
| - | <WRAP center round important 60> | + | |
| - | bloc important | + | {{ : |
| - | </ | + | |
| - | <WRAP center round help 60> | + | ==== 2. Requête SQL ==== |
| - | bloc aide | + | Il faut ensuite renseigner la requête SQL que l'on souhaite exécuter. |
| - | </ | + | |
| - | <WRAP center round todo 60> | + | {{ : |
| - | bloc à faire | + | |
| - | </ | + | ==== 3. Choix de la base de données et dossier d' |
| - | <WRAP center round alert 60> | + | Il est possible de spécifier dans le script sur quelle base de donnée l'on souhaite travailler ainsi que le dossier dans lequel on souhaite effectuer l' |
| - | bloc alerte | + | |
| - | </ | + | {{ : |
| + | |||
| - | <wrap em> | + | ===== III. Exécution du script ===== |
| - | <wrap hi> | + | Pour finir, il ne reste plus qu'à exécuter le script. Pour cela, il faut : |
| - | <wrap lo>peu important</ | + | - Ouvrir Powershell. |
| + | - Se placer dans le dossier dans lequel le script est présent. | ||
| + | - Renseigner le nom du script (avec l' | ||
| + | {{ : | ||
| + | Une autre solution pour éxécuter le script est de faire clic droit sur le fichier .PS1 puis " | ||
| - | {{tag>modbus RS485 pcvue Sécurité test_deux_mot}} | + | {{tag>Extractions_automatiques Extraction_automatique SQL AB Extractions Extraction |
| - | Les tags peuvent : | ||
| - | * être associés à une catégorie. | ||
| - | * Contenir plusieurs mots. Dans ce cas, remplacer les espaces par des **_** | ||